about

This release is a soundtrack to C.L. Moore's "Black God's Kiss," first published in the October issue of Weird Tales in 1934.

Each track captures a moment in the story following Jirel of Joiry, the fierce commander of Joiry's military, as she journeys into unholy darkness to get her revenge. After facing defeat in battle and being imprisoned by her foe, Jirel escapes the dungeon and dives into a hellish dimension full of horrors seeking a cursed weapon to defeat her enemy. In exchange for all the light in her world, Jirel embraces eternal damnation to exact vengeance.

All of the music was made using FamiTracker.
